This small village stands at the confluence of the Gorges of the Tarn and the Jonte, and with access to all four of the Grands Causses, the high limestone plateaux. Originally the limestone was laid down evenly but over the millennia, the Rivers divided it into four blocks, – the Causses Sauveterre, Mejean, Noir and Larzac. Le Rozier is a larger village than Peyreleau, although only half a kilometre away and is where all the shops and most of the restaurants are.
